The PROGRESS Trial: A Prospective, Randomized, Controlled Trial to Assess the Management of Moderate Aortic Stenosis by Clinical Surveillance or Transcatheter Aortic Valve Replacement
Summary: This study objective is to establish the safety and effectiveness of the Edwards SAPIEN 3 / SAPIEN 3 Ultra / SAPIEN 3 Ultra RESILIA Transcatheter Heart Valve systems in subjects with moderate, calcific aortic stenosis. Following completion of enrollment, subjects will be eligible for enrollment in the continued access phase of the trial.

A Study to Assess Safety and Effectiveness of the JenaValve Trilogy™ Transcatheter Heart Valve System Versus Surgical Valve Replacement in Patients With Aortic Regurgitation
Summary: To demonstrate non-inferiority of the Trilogy Transcatheter Heart Valve (THV) System compared with surgical aortic valve replacement (SAVR) for treatment of subjects with clinically significant native aortic regurgitation (AR)

Transcatheter Aortic Valve Replacement For Patients With Bicuspid Aortic Stenosis (Type 0) Using Down Sizing Strategy Compared With Standard Sizing Strategy (HANGZHOU Solution): A Prospective, Multicenter, Randomized Controlled Trial
Summary: To compare down sizing strategy versus annular sizing strategy technique (control group) in Type 0 bicuspid aortic stenosis (AS) patients undergoing transcatheter aortic valve replacement (TAVR) with self-expanding valves (SEVs): a randomized superiority trial
Improved Outcomes With Pre-Procedure Shockwave IVL of Common Femoral Artery Access Site Prior to Large Bore Access and Pre-Closure
Summary: The primary purpose of this study is to observe reduced access site complications in patients with heavily calcified common femoral arteries requiring Transcatheter Aortic Valve Replacement (TAVR)
Clinical Trial of the Results of Allegra vs Sapien Transcatheter Aortic Valves in Valve-In-Valve Indication
Summary: The VIVALL-2 study is a randomized trial to compare the self-expandable supra-annular Allegra and the balloon-expandable intra-annular Edwards transcatheter valve systems in patients with degenerated biological aortic surgical valve.
REdo tranScatheter Aortic Valve Replacement for Transcatheter aOrtic Valve failuRE
Summary: The purpose of this study is to generate clinical evidence on valve safety and performance in subjects treated by redo Transcatheter Aortic Valve Replacement (TAVR).
First in Human Study of the GEMINUS Transcatheter Aortic Valve Implantation System in Patients With Severe Symptomatic Aortic Stenosis
Summary: The main objective of this study is to evaluate the feasibility and safety of the GEMINUS system in patients with severe symptomatic aortic stenosis. This is a prospective, open label, multicentre, single arm, first in human clinical study. Clinical follow up for all patients will be performed at 30 days, 6 months, 1, 2, 3, 4 and 5 years post-implantation
